MSPS Class of '82 Visits KHAIRUN, Pledges Support for Education

A delegation from Masallachi Special Primary School (MSPS) Kano, Class of 1982, paid a courtesy visit to Khalifa Isyaku Rabiu University, Kano (KHAIRUN), on February 6, 2025, reaffirming their commitment to advancing education in Kano State.

Leading the delegation, Engr. Magaji Hussaini congratulated Prof. Abdulrashid Garba on his appointment as the university’s pioneer Vice Chancellor. He praised KHAIRUN’s rapid strides in academia and called for collaboration in improving government schools, particularly in upgrading infrastructure to enhance learning conditions for underprivileged students.

In his remarks, Prof. Garba commended the MSPS alumni for their dedication to educational development. He reiterated that education is a shared responsibility and assured that KHAIRUN remains committed to fostering academic excellence and contributing to the growth of learning institutions in Kano State.

The visit underscored the university’s role as a key stakeholder in shaping the future of education and strengthening community partnerships for sustainable development.
